Just did it. Disable LTE and cellular data and it will limit everything to wifi only. When you are on wifi you will get iMessages but no regular texts. Your phone will also not ring unless you have it set up with some wifi-enabled calling app. If you get in a bind enable your cellular data long enough to get a text out, it is usually $0.50 per, worth it if you absolutely need it.
